Should the New York Knicks sign JJ Redick this offseason?

Rumors of JJ Redick becoming a Knick circulated at last year’s trade deadline, but it wasn’t meant to be.

Now, with the choice firmly up to the two sides – it could come to fruition.

The Knicks made do with their shooters last season, but an experienced veteran sharpshooter like Redick could be a valuable addition.

He’s only missed the playoffs once in his entire career – he’s seen what winning takes.

In the twilight of his career, the experienced guard could provide the Knicks with an off the bench spark plug.

Although he only played in 13 games with the Dallas Mavericks after being acquired at the deadline, he still shot .395% from the three-point line.

You can never have too many veterans who can shoot the ball – Redick fits the bill.
